Ceiling Fan Wiring in Kansas City, KS
Ceiling fan wiring services involve installing, repairing, or upgrading the electrical connections necessary for ceiling fans to operate safely and efficiently. This service covers a variety of projects, including new installations in homes or businesses, replacing outdated or malfunctioning fans, and adjusting wiring to accommodate ceiling fans with integrated lighting or remote controls. Property owners often seek these services to improve room comfort, enhance energy efficiency, or update their existing electrical systems to meet current standards.
Before requesting ceiling fan wiring services, property owners typically want to understand the scope of work involved, including whether existing wiring can support a new fan or if additional electrical components are needed. It’s also helpful to know if the wiring complies with local electrical codes and to clarify any requirements for remote controls, light kits, or variable speed controls. Proper wiring ensures the ceiling fan functions correctly and safely, providing reliable comfort and airflow throughout the space.

Common Ceiling Fan Wiring Jobs
Ceiling fan wiring installation - involves connecting new ceiling fans to existing electrical systems for safe operation.
Ceiling fan wiring upgrades - updates outdated wiring to meet current safety standards and support modern fans.
Ceiling fan switch wiring - replaces or adds switches to control ceiling fans conveniently from different locations.
Ceiling fan junction box wiring - ensures proper wiring connections within ceiling boxes for secure fan mounting.
Ceiling fan control wiring - integrates dimmer or remote controls for enhanced fan operation and comfort.
Ceiling fan troubleshooting wiring issues - identifies and resolves wiring problems affecting fan performance and safety.
Ceiling Fan Wiring Questions
What is involved in ceiling fan wiring? Ceiling fan wiring includes connecting the fan's electrical components to the existing ceiling electrical box, ensuring proper grounding and switch connections for safe operation.
Can existing wiring support a new ceiling fan? Many ceiling fans can be installed using existing wiring, but it’s important to verify that the electrical box and wiring are suitable for the fan’s requirements.
Are special switches needed for ceiling fans? Some ceiling fans require a dedicated wall switch or remote control receiver, which may involve additional wiring to accommodate different control options.
What should property owners know before wiring a ceiling fan? Ensuring the electrical box is securely rated for fan weight and that wiring connections follow safety standards helps ensure proper installation and operation.
